The Chrysanthemums By John Steinbeck Summary. The Chrysanthemums. The action of the story takes place on a single Saturday right at the end of the year. The Chrysanthemums by John Steinbeck is a short story about Elisa Allen who is pruning her new crop of chrysanthemums when a tradesman in a cart asks for directions and offers to work for her. The protagonist Elisa Allen feels that her life is deprived of emotional and intellectual intimacy.

A revised version which contained less sexual imagery was published in the 1938 collection The Long Valley. Summary Analysis A high grey-flannel fog has isolated the Salinas Valley like a closed pot The cut yellow hay fields look as though they are bathed in sunshine though there is none in December in the valley and a slight southwestern breeze suggests rain despite the heavy fog. As a 35 year old woman she is childless and extremely dissatisfied in her passionless marriage to her well-meaning but utterly clueless husband Henry. Her frustration stems from not having a child and from her husbands failure to admire her romantically as a woman. One of John Steinbeck s most accomplished short stories The Chrysanthemums is about an intelligent creative woman coerced into a stifling existence on her husbands ranch.
